One say AGM based, one Lithium based ? - both 48Volt,

You can of course run two Mutipluses, both feeding power into the same AC network (like grid-tied inverters) from separate battery banks charged by separate PV arrays. You can't put one Multi on the output of another though (not an officially supported configuration), so if the grid fails you will have two islands, each with their own loads on the output.

With the external control function you can even implement your own control system, (using modbus-TCP), eg make the one Multi charge while the other one feeds into the grid, passing power from one battery bank to the other.

I've often considered doing something like this for the fun of it. I have a 24V 3kva for the house, and a 12V 3KVA on the test bench. So exactly this scenario: Two battery banks, two inverters. It would make sense to use the test bench inverter to offset peaks and to recharge it when there is surplus, using a clever software mechanism of some sort. This is the tricky bit 🙂

Do they not go out of sync if the one fails before the other one? I was under the impression that it would cause problems.

16 minutes ago, SilverNodashi said:

Do they not go out of sync if the one fails before the other one?

They tie with the grid. When the grid drops, they both Island. It's the same in principle as if you and your neighbour both have a grid-tied inverter and you happen to be on the same phase. The difference is that it's a battery hybrid, and they happen to be on the same premises, but it works the same: Both work together to reduce your consumption when the grid is on. When the grid fails, then you end up with two islands instead of one.

You might of course opt to put your emergency/backup loads on only one of them and use the other one purely for peak shaving.
